Produktbeschreibung
This book presents quantum mechanics through a systematic progression from classical atomic models to modern quantum theory. Beginning with foundational concepts, the text develops Schrödinger's equation and its applications to fundamental quantum systems. Mathematical rigor is balanced with physical interpretation throughout.

  • Detailed derivations of quantum mechanical principles
  • Comprehensive treatment of particle systems, rigid rotators, and harmonic oscillators
  • In-depth analysis of hydrogen atom wavefunctions and multi-electron systems
  • Applications to rotational, vibrational, and electronic spectroscopy
  • Comparative presentation of Valence Bond and Molecular Orbital theories


Ideal for advanced undergraduate and graduate students in chemistry and physics.
